KHC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

982 of the 5,651 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kraft Heinz (KHC)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$25.9B — up 18% from $22B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 169 funds opened new KHC positions and 76 closed out — a net gain of 93 holders — while 336 added to existing stakes and 326 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, opening a new position worth an estimated $396M. The largest seller was American International Group, cutting an estimated $197M.
